6 Reasons Home Swapping is Sustainable
Traveling can generate a lot of trash. With carry out, to-go drinks, and meals, everything is throw-away. Home swapping is the most sustainable way to travel. By trading houses, we're using the resources that we already have - our houses - and sharing. Systems are set up already for recycling, composting, and reusing. 5 Reasons to Home Swap
While more people are renting homes, rooms, garden apartments or just a sofa for traveling, there's another option that's even better: home swapping. What is home swapping?
